Why ex-athletes are a great addition to the corporate world.

Nicholas Mailey, Vice President, Global Talent Acquisition and Kelly Kayser, Senior Director, Talent Acquisition

May 15, 2023

Servant leadership is a vital trait that companies seek in leaders and their team members. It involves fostering a culture of trust, diversity of thought, and an unselfish mindset, while prioritizing the success of others. Similarly, these are successful elements for people in sport Competitive sports offer the chance to build and strengthen these leadership attributes 

Through competition, athletes learn self-discipline, the need to adapt to opportunities, and continued teamwork. Athletes are equipped with winning attitudes and a learning mindset - all critical traits for success in the business world. Changing careers can be challenging, but due to the athletes’ years of training, coaching and self-discipline, organizations that give these exceptionally talented people resources or opportunities often gain from their unique blend of qualities. This initiative was a huge success, and Equinix decided to expand its efforts in hiring former athletes across the globe. 

Marilyn Okoro, Robert Wojcik and Danielle Brown joined Equinix after transitioning from their sports careers. Their previous careers as athletes helped them develop critical skills for success, which they have been able to put to use in the corporate side of life. Sports taught them about drive, dedication and perseverance, and it taught them how to work with a team and the importance of communication. 

When asked about her experience working at Equinix, Marylin Okoro said, “I am proud of the difference we are making under the DIB space, because this is making a huge impact and changing generations of patterns for many of our young talent joining the workforce. I am also proud to be advocating for athletes and to have been able to support the recruitment of three fellow athletes since I joined.” 

When asked about sports and their impact on his corporate life, Robert Wojcik said, “Teamwork, communication, confidence, self-discipline, work ethic, mental toughness and thriving in a high-performance setting. These are just a couple of the skills that helped me and will continue to help me as I progress and continue at Equinix that I had learned as an athlete. I have also been driven by my competitiveness my whole life, and I certainly don’t see that changing now!” 

“The role looks challenging and interesting, and I can’t wait to get started. What excites me the most, though, are the people. Through the interview process and doing research, I’ve heard such wonderful things about the culture of Equinix and how important its values are. If you’re in an environment that helps you grow and focuses on winning as a team, I truly believe that you can achieve some incredible things,” said Danielle Brown when asked about her excitement about joining Equinix.
